Transaction 73ef384a3ddcf721cdb418e97cb3b89a1494d46db0a77b8a9864fe6cf4bf72f1

1 Input
2 Outputs
  • 73ef384a3ddcf721cdb418e97cb3b89a1494d46db0a77b8a9864fe6cf4bf72f1:0
  • value  50000
    address  3K5zgMa9X6YyY7mwWNJbS7VJrsV8HVAAZS
  • 73ef384a3ddcf721cdb418e97cb3b89a1494d46db0a77b8a9864fe6cf4bf72f1:1
  • value  12544859
    address  3ATfHf99SDz96zwSw66cAZLjaHWNyDAk6T